Psalm 22:1 states, \u201cMy God, my God, why have you forsaken me?\u00a0 Christ cried out these same words in Mark 15:34. Psalm 22:18 describes evildoers casting lots for the clothing.\u00a0 This was fulfilled by Christ in John 19:23-24.\u00a0 In verse 16 the psalmist also writes about the Messiah\u2019s hands and feet being pierced.\u00a0 This Psalm is anticipatory, as it awaits the suffering of Christ, and his victory.<\/p>\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.pexels.com\/photo\/grayscale-photo-of-the-crucifix-977659\/\" class=\" decorated-link\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"jetpack-lazy-image jetpack-lazy-image--handled\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/images.pexels.com\/photos\/977659\/pexels-photo-977659.jpeg?w=736&amp;ssl=1\" alt=\"Grayscale Photo Of The Crucifix\" data-recalc-dims=\"1\" data-lazy-loaded=\"1\"><\/a><\/figure>\n<div class=\"code-block code-block-5\"><\/div>\n<p data-adtags-visited=\"true\">Psalm 45 is also considered a Messianic Psalm because whole sections are used in the epistle to the Hebrews.\u00a0 The author of the Epistle uses Psalm 45:6-7 to establish the superiority of Christ.\u00a0 In this passage He is described as the king forever, and thus his superiority is established.<\/p>\n<h2>Make Your Enemies Your Footstool<\/h2>\n<p data-adtags-visited=\"true\">Perhaps one of the greatest examples one could give of the Messiah in the Psalms is Psalm 110.\u00a0 This is seen in verse one which states, \u201cThe Lord says to my Lord: \u2018Sit at my right hand, until I make your enemies your footstool.\u201d\u00a0 This very passage is quoted in Mark 12:36-37, and Christ says that it is David who was speaking about Him.<\/p>\n<p data-adtags-visited=\"true\">This Psalm also makes an appearance in the book of Acts and is quoted by Peter in his sermon on Pentecost.\u00a0 This Psalm also refers to Christ as being a priest in the order of Melchizadek (Psalm 110:4).\u00a0 This parallels with Hebrew 5:6, as the author utilizes this Psalm describe Christ as high priest.<\/p>\n<p data-adtags-visited=\"true\">These are only some of the passages in Psalms that speak of the Messiah.\u00a0 There are several more such as chapters 18, 61, 72, 89, 132, and 144.\u00a0 In addition, there are several more Psalms that were quotes directly by Christ to describe various things in man\u2019s life.<\/p>\n<h2>Good Friday<\/h2>\n<p data-adtags-visited=\"true\">Psalm 22 has a very special correlation to Good Friday as Jesus repeats those words in his final breathes.\u00a0 There is much going on in the world, and there may be temptation to ask where God is.\u00a0 God is still with you though it may not seem like it.\u00a0 In Christ we see the image of his ultimate love for us.\u00a0 The act on the cross was prophesied in many places in the Old Testament.\u00a0 The Psalms, especially Psalm 22, almost give a first person account of one who experienced such torment.<\/p>\n<p data-adtags-visited=\"true\">I urge you to mediate today on the events that took place those many years ago.\u00a0 Fast and pray for the events unfolding in the world.\u00a0 It is only Jesus that will bring about healing.\u00a0 On the first Good Friday he took the first step by dying for the redemption of all men.
